Get to Know Your Customers Day happens more than once a year. It happens January 19, April 19, July 19, and October 18. You have no more excuses not to use this special day as a chance to show your appreciation and earn loyal customers. You can have fun with this several times a year!

Take Advantage of Get to Know Your Customers Day on Facebook

Do you have a Facebook Page for your business? If you do, no doubt you have thought about how to engage your fans/readers more effectively.

This special day is too great of an opportunity to pass by! You can have each customer help you to celebrate by entering something about themselves, you can ask just about anything and offer a prize for one of those who answer! Here are some ideas:

- Have them enter the reason why they love your business.
- Have them enter their birthday (year not needed). This is great information as you can send customers a birthday card! Imagine their surprise.
- Ask them to list their favorite hobby. This will help you to see if your fan base may be interested in something you can successfully market.
- Have them list a fun fact about themselves or just anything in general.

The possibilities are endless for using this day to your advantage and having some fun on Facebook. Be sure to offer a small prize to a random winner who takes the time to answer your survey or comment. This will encourage participation, which is what you want!
